SCI Engineered Materials Inc. (OTCMKTS:SCIA – Get Free Report) saw a large growth in short interest in July. As of July 31st, there was short interest totaling 8,701 shares, a growth of 2,069.8% from the July 15th total of 401 shares. Currently, 0.2% of the company’s stock are sold short. Based on an average trading volume of 23,611 shares, the short-interest ratio is presently 0.4 days.
SCI Engineered Materials Stock Performance
SCIA traded up $0.21 on Tuesday, hitting $9.40. 22,415 shares of the company were exchanged, compared to its average volume of 11,705. The stock’s fifty day moving average is $7.61 and its 200-day moving average is $6.41. SCI Engineered Materials has a 12 month low of $3.81 and a 12 month high of $9.44. The company has a market cap of $41.83 million, a PE ratio of 15.93 and a beta of 1.08.
SCI Engineered Materials (OTCMKTS:SCIA –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, July 30th. The company reported $0.26 earnings per share for the quarter. SCI Engineered Materials had a return on equity of 18.52% and a net margin of 8.97%.The firm had revenue of $9.49 million for the quarter.
SCI Engineered Materials Company Profile
SCI Engineered Materials, Inc engages in the manufacture and supply of materials for physical vapor deposition thin film applications in the United States. It offers ceramic targets, metal sputtering targets, and backing plates for use in semiconductors, thin film solar, flat panel displays, defense, aerospace, and photonics industries. The company’s materials are used to produce nano layers of metals and oxides for advanced material systems; and in applying decorative coatings for end uses, such as sink faucets to produce various electronic, photonic, and semiconductor products.
